In the midst of all this traveling fun, we have been taking a class to become Peer Visitors. The hospitals are using people to visit with new stroke survivors to encourage them and their familys. It has been good for us wheather we ever get involved in visiting or not, although I believe we will. We have learned much more about stroke in general, and his. We have met other very nice stroke survivors who have very sucessfully moved on with their lives. Next week, we have our graduation!
